The Rotating Altar

Remembering the Names of the Divine Feminine

altar with crescent moon candle holder, crystal chalice, incense and moonstone and selenite rocks
Under the Waning Moon

We Gather to Remember...

The Rotating Altar is a monthly virtual circle where ancient Goddess mythology becomes medicine for modern times. Each gathering explores a different face of the Divine Feminine weaving storytelling, art, astrology, tarot, and meditation to help you connect with the past in a meaningful way for your present.

What to Expect

The Experience

  • 45-60 min Ritual over Zoom
  • Breath work, meditation & reflection
  • Creative inspiration, journal prompts and/or ritual ideas
  • Recording will be sent after (available for a month).

Who This is For

 Anyone curious about Goddess mythology, regardless of experience or gender. Whether you're seeking deeper spiritual connection, exploring the feminine divine, or simply hungry for stories that matter, you are welcome.
